University extension in the virtual space:

Impacts on compliance with its guidelines

Abstract

The extensions actions underwent a curricularization process, following norms that indicates the physical space as an ideal place to operate, an item that has been adapted due to the changes generates by the Covid-19 pandemic. Ir was essencial to adapt extension projects to digital technologies, online dynamics and cyberculture. This article investigates how 2 of the extention’s guidelines - dialogical interaction and the student’s citizenship training - were impacted by the adoption of these environments as a place of action for the Numa project, of the Fashion course at Udesc. Thus, a mapping of extension projects for this course was carried out, a survey of the actions carried out in 2022 and the categorization of the place where each action was carried out. Next, a qualitative analysis of Numma’s actions was carried out. In the end, it was served how the changes intensified, which ones are in line with the digital dynamics, which ones are not, and which could be the ways to apply these actions in the online environment.
